We propose here an alternative interpretation of the fermi-linarization approach to interacting electron systems, based on the requirement that the coefficients of the linearized operators are Clifford-like variables, whose anticommutator equals an unknown constant $c$. We apply the approximation to the Falicov-Kimball model, explicitly solving the self-consistency equation for the unknown, which turns out to behave as an order parameter. We discuss its relation with a metal-insulator transition and some thermodynamical quantities. In particular we show that our approximation in the $T=0$ limit reproduces exactly the Gutzwiller results for the Hubbard model.
